Glass Curtain Walls Glass curtain walls are lightweight aluminum-framed facades housing glass or metal panels. These glazing systems don’t support the weight of a roof or floor. Instead, gravity loads and wind resistance transfer from the surface to the building’s floor line. Curtain walls are often part of a building envelope or comprises one part of a […]
Residential curtain wall systems. Like commercial glass curtain walls, residential curtain wall systems envelope buildings in non-structural glass and aluminum facades that transfer loads and resistance to the building’s main structure. These glazing systems utilize thermally broken heavy duty glass panes for optimal heat efficiency.
